PR gdb/14704:
* gdb_bfd.c (gdb_bfd_ref): Set BFD_DECOMPRESS. (zlib_decompress_section): Remove. (gdb_bfd_map_section): Only check for compressed section in mmap case. Use bfd_get_full_section_contents. * osabi.c (check_note): Add 'sectsize' argument. Read section data. (generic_elf_osabi_sniff_abi_tag_sections): Don't read section data. Update for check_note change. * xcoffread.c (xcoff_initial_scan): Use bfd_get_full_section_contents. * py-auto-load.c (auto_load_section_scripts): Use bfd_get_full_section_contents. * contrib/cc-with-tweaks.sh: Add -Z option. testsuite * gdb.base/comprdebug.exp: New file.
